This position is for Project Specialist Sr located in Moorestown, NJ. This Project Specialist will report directly to a First Line Manager within the Sensors Mechanical Design and Test organization and will :
Serve as the Solid State Radar Common Product Project Lead (PM) responsible for leading execution of the Active Electronically Scanned Array (AESA) On Array and Off Array Products
Oversee cost, schedule, and technical execution, resource planning, and coordination across Solid State Radar programs to ensure that contract and investment deliverables are completed on time, achieving business commitments
Collaborate across functional lines to develop and execute program plans, provide risk and opportunity management, and develop product roadmaps
Act as the functional focal point for communications between program teams, program leadership and functional organizations
Gain experience with cutting edge solid state radar technologies, Program Management, customer relationships, product portfolio management, cross functional team leadership, high rate production, integration & test, and strategy development
